Transaction eb62725b96811f219560edf8294949313b2a8ffe94d7771842cc2fae7dde3797
1 Input
1 Output
-
eb62725b96811f219560edf8294949313b2a8ffe94d7771842cc2fae7dde3797:0
- value
- 137871
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5e8c3d7ada114ce28a754c17e6bab91bf46168b
- address
- bc1qch5v84ad5y2vu2982nqhu6atjxl5v95t4697yv